Gastropoda: : Trochoidea: Calliostomatidae

Calliostoma sayanum Dall, 1889


Range: 35.02°N to 24.57°N; 83.57°W to 75.2°W
Depth: 119 to 366 m (live 219 to 219 m)
Maximum Reported Size: 39  mm

Calliostoma (Eutrochus) sayanum Dall, 1889a, p. 370-371, pl. 33, figs. 10-11
[Basis of the current name]
Type Locality: USFC sta. 2594, 20 miles southeast from Cape Hatteras, N. C.
Range: 35.02°N to 24.57°N; 83.57°W to 75.2°W
Depth: 119 to 366 m (live 219 m)
Maximum Reported Size: 39 mm
Distribution: USA: North Carolina, Florida: East Florida, Florida Keys, Dry Tortugas
References: Dall (1889a) lNE; Clench & Turner (1960) SW; Quinn (1979) Dd


Partial List of References

Dall, W. H. 1889. Reports on the results of dredgings, under the supervision of Alexander Agassiz, in the Gulf of Mexico (1877-78) and in the Caribbean Sea (1879-80), by the U. S. Coast Survey Steamer 'Blake,' Bulletin of the Museum of Comparative Zoology 18 1-492, pls. 10-40. [Stated date: 08 Jun 1889.]
